Abstract

<p>The biomimetics has been applied in many fields while its application in structural engineering has not been fully promoted. The applicability of bi-valve shells to spatial structures have been investigated, however, the usefulness of bi-valve shell is not revealed. This is because the mechanical and geometric properties of bi-valve shells are not understood due to its complex shape. In this study, a novel method for measuring mechanical and geometric properties of real shaped bi-valve shell by using X-ray CT images is proposed. Thickness and curvature, and stress evaluation on dead load analyzed using the model created by CT images.</p>
